How Do You Landscape A Dry Creek Bed. A dry creek bed also known as a dry stream bed is a gully or trench usually lined with stones and edged with plants to mimic a natural riparian area. For an edgy touch place a piece or two of driftwood on the sides. A dry creek bed is an effective drainage solution but it can also be an attractive landscape feature that needs very little maintenance. Curve the path for a more.
